About The Position

Holy Innocents Episcopal School is seeking a Middle School Health and Physical Education Teacher . The teacher is responsible for developing students physical fitness and health awareness while promoting discipline, sportsmanship, teamwork, and lifelong wellness. HIES is the largest Episcopal Parish day school in the country, offering a fully accredited college preparatory program for students age three through 12th grade. The school is located north of downtown Atlanta between I-75 and GA 400.
